A 5-month checkup on your 2019 business goals
May 9, 2019Back in December of last year I wrote a blog about setting goals for 2019. It starts out with “Yes, it is December already. It’s that time of year when you reflect on the challenges your business has achieved, crushed, fallen short of or come close to over the past 12 months…”
Let’s update this to: YES, it is May already. Now is the time to reflect, adjust and take action on where you are with your 2019 goals.
Revisit these powerful and thought-provoking questions:
- Do you have infrastructure and resources in place to meet your company goals?
- What are the biggest challenges facing your company today?
- How do you keep up-to-date with ever-changing employment regulations that affect employees?
- What would you change about your employee retention and recruiting strategy?
- How confident are you that you are complying with wage-and-hour, immigration and wrongful termination practices?
Strategize using your answers to these questions and prepare to take action.
